Mountain People Cheesy Grits-N-Eggs
1/2 cup grits, polenta if you mst
4 eggs
1/2 cup grated cheese, fancy if you need it
A big splash of milk or cream
S & P
Boil 1 1/2 cups of water; then add grits.
Switch to low heat, cover and leave for 20 minutes.
Beat eggs and dairy and add to grits with salt and pepper.
Stir over low heat until eggs are cooked and cheese is melted.
Makes 2 big bowl fulls.
